Output 84b39c8587397bedbc75425a7b7b02a69d22bd35253530ffaba3d49013e673aa:2

value
4915470627
script pubkey
OP_HASH160 OP_PUSHBYTES_20 baacb66e346e5198ca95df2b35644e55dca1a9de OP_EQUAL
address
3Ji4WWP2kLewdRziwA4aJ3Xu99FvtwtPAU
transaction
84b39c8587397bedbc75425a7b7b02a69d22bd35253530ffaba3d49013e673aa
spent
true